Find the best attractions near Fearnan

Fearnan, located in Aberfeldy, Scotland, is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and romantic getaways. Visitors can explore stunning castles, picturesque lakes, and informative visitor centers. This charming destination offers a blend of culture, adventure, and natural beauty, making it an ideal spot for travelers seeking memorable experiences in a scenic setting.

  • Taymouth Castle: Nestled 6.4km from Fearnan, Taymouth Castle exudes romance and culture. This stunning 19th-century castle boasts impressive architecture and beautifully landscaped gardens, making it a perfect spot for leisurely strolls and photography.
  • Fortingall Yew: Located 3.2km away, the Fortingall Yew is a remarkable ancient tree steeped in history and folklore. Believed to be over 5,000 years old, it offers a unique glimpse into Scotland's cultural heritage and is a serene spot for reflection.
  • Loch Tummel: A scenic 16.1km drive from Fearnan leads you to Loch Tummel, where outdoor adventures await. This picturesque lake features stunning views, romantic beaches, and opportunities for hiking, making it ideal for nature lovers.

Best time to go to Fearnan

The best time to visit Fearnan can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Fearnan fal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Fearnan fal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January33.6°F (0.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February34.0°F (1.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
April40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May45.5°F (7.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August52.5°F (11.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
October44.2°F (6.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November38.7°F (3.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December34.5°F (1.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the weather like in Fearnan?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 52°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 35°F. Average annual precipitation for Fearnan is 57 inches.
